在当今数字化时代,网页已成为人们获取信息、进行交流的重要平台。而表单作为网页与用户互动的重要方式,其设计的好坏直接影响用户体验。本文将为您详细解析响应式表单设计全攻略,助您打造高效互动的网页。
一、理解响应式表单
响应式表单指的是在不同设备上都能良好展示和使用的表单。随着移动设备的普及,响应式表单设计变得越来越重要。以下是响应式表单设计的关键点:
1. 适应不同屏幕尺寸
响应式表单应能适应不同屏幕尺寸,包括桌面、平板和手机。这需要我们关注以下几个方面:
- 弹性布局:使用百分比、视口单位(vw、vh)等弹性布局方式,使表单元素在不同屏幕上自动调整大小。
- 媒体查询:利用CSS媒体查询,针对不同屏幕尺寸应用不同的样式规则。
2. 优化输入体验
在移动设备上,用户操作表单的难度更大。以下是一些优化输入体验的方法:
- 大号按钮:为按钮设置较大的尺寸,方便用户点击。
- 自动填充:利用HTML5的自动填充功能,减少用户输入。
- 输入提示:提供清晰的输入提示,帮助用户正确填写信息。
3. 确保表单功能完善
响应式表单应具备以下功能:
- 验证功能:实时验证用户输入,确保信息准确无误。
- 错误提示:当用户输入错误时,及时给出错误提示,方便用户纠正。
- 提交功能:提供简洁明了的提交按钮,方便用户提交信息。
二、响应式表单设计技巧
以下是一些响应式表单设计技巧,帮助您提升设计水平:
1. 简化表单结构
尽量简化表单结构,减少用户填写的信息量。以下是一些建议:
- 合并字段:将多个相关字段合并为一个。
- 使用复选框或单选按钮:代替文本输入,提高填写效率。
2. 精确控制输入格式
对于需要特定格式的输入(如电话号码、邮箱地址等),应使用相应的HTML5输入类型(如tel、email等)。
3. 利用图标和颜色
使用图标和颜色来增强表单的视觉效果,提高用户体验。
4. 优化加载速度
响应式表单应尽量轻量,减少加载时间。以下是一些建议:
- 压缩图片:使用压缩工具减小图片大小。
- 合并CSS和JavaScript文件:减少HTTP请求次数。
三、案例分析
以下是一些优秀的响应式表单设计案例:
- Airbnb:Airbnb的表单设计简洁明了,便于用户填写。
- Dropbox:Dropbox的表单设计注重用户体验,提供实时验证功能。
- Slack:Slack的表单设计采用扁平化风格,简洁大方。
四、总结
响应式表单设计是打造高效互动网页的关键。通过理解响应式表单、掌握设计技巧和借鉴优秀案例,您将能设计出既美观又实用的表单,提升用户体验。希望本文对您有所帮助!
